One-line verdict
The Sunny Health & Fitness Multifunctional Strength Training Home Gym delivers smooth cable operation and wide exercise versatility at a budget price, yet its plate-loaded design requires buyers to purchase additional plates and its assembly instructions frustrate many first-time users.
How it compares
- vs Marcy MWM-990 Multifunctional Home Gym ($500–$600): Sunny Health & Fitness wins on price and cable smoothness, Marcy MWM-990 wins on included weight stack (no extra plates needed)
- vs OPPSDECOR Smith Machine with LAT Pull Down ($250–$350): Sunny Health & Fitness wins on cable smoothness and exercise variety, OPPSDECOR wins on guided Smith machine motion for solo lifters
- vs SincMill Home Gym Multifunctional ($500–$600): Sunny Health & Fitness wins on price and cable operation smoothness, SincMill wins on resistance capacity without requiring additional plate purchases
- vs Sportsroyals Power Rack with Pulley System ($300–$350): Sunny Health & Fitness wins on cable versatility and exercise variety, Sportsroyals wins on power cage barbell functionality and open-rack access
AI-summarized review themes
Frequently Praised
- Smooth cable and pulley motion, even under heavy resistance
- Versatile pulley positions support nearly any exercise angle
- Solid build quality despite budget price point
- Excellent value once assembled and in daily use
- Compact footprint fits small home-gym spaces
Frequently Criticized
- Assembly instructions are tiny and poorly illustrated
- Requires watching third-party videos to finish assembly
- Box arrives damaged or heavily worn in transit
- Plate-loaded design adds extra cost for weight plates
Best for
Beginner home-gym setups, apartment dwellers with limited space, users supplementing bodyweight or dumbbell training
Not for
Buyers seeking quick, frustration-free assembly, users who want weight-stack convenience, heavy lifters needing instant heavy loads
